The Mechanics Behind Digital Reels

Digital reels in online slots operate using a Random Number Generator (RNG) that continuously produces thousands of number sequences per second. When you press spin, the RNG selects a specific number, which maps to a predetermined position on each virtual reel. Unlike physical slot machines, these virtual reels are stored as software arrays, often containing far more “stops” than the visible symbols suggest. This allows for complex payline configurations and variable symbol weighting. The result of each spin is determined entirely by this RNG output, meaning the random number generation is instantaneous and independent of previous or future spins, ensuring each outcome is purely chance-based.

Paylines, Ways to Win, and Cluster Pays

Paylines are fixed, predefined paths across the reels that require matching symbols on consecutive positions to trigger a payout, typically from left to right. Ways to Win eliminate paylines entirely by paying for any adjacent matching symbols regardless of position, drastically increasing winning potential per spin. Cluster Pays operate on a grid where groups of identical symbols touching horizontally or vertically form a win, with larger clusters exponentially increasing multipliers. The core distinction lies in symbol arrangement: Paylines demand specific patterns, Ways to Win reward any directional adjacency, and Cluster Pays require contiguous group formation.

Mechanic Winning Condition Symbol Arrangement
Paylines Matching symbols on fixed, sequential lines Consecutive from leftmost or both directions
Ways to Win Matching symbols on adjacent reels (any row) No fixed pattern; all positions active
Cluster Pays Matching symbols in contiguous groups (grid) Adjacent horizontally and/or vertically

Return to Player Percentages and Volatility Explained

Return to Player (RTP) and volatility are the two metrics that define your slot experience. RTP, a theoretical percentage, indicates how much a game pays back over infinite spins, letting you compare long-term value between titles. Volatility, however, dictates variance in slot payouts: low volatility offers frequent, smaller wins to extend playtime, while high volatility delivers larger but rarer payouts. Pairing a high RTP with low volatility protects your bankroll, whereas high volatility matched with moderate RTP risks rapid swings. Understanding these factors lets you select games aligning with your risk appetite, transforming spin choices from random guesses into strategic decisions.

Wilds, Scatters, and Multipliers in Action

Wild symbols dynamically substitute for other icons to complete winning paylines, transforming near-misses into payouts. Scatters trigger free spins rounds or bonus games regardless of their position on the reels, often appearing stacked for increased frequency. Multipliers then amplify every win within these features, with some cascading and increasing after consecutive victories. Together, they create a volatile, high-reward loop where one scatter-triggered spin can cascade into multiplied wilds. This synergy is the core driver of slot volatility.

Low, Medium, and High Variance Options

Low variance options deliver frequent, small wins, preserving a player’s bankroll over extended sessions. Medium variance strikes a precise balance, offering moderate payouts at a steadier clip than high variance. High variance options feature infrequent but substantial rewards, requiring patience and a larger bankroll. Selecting the right variance directly impacts a slot’s volatility and session duration, which is a core aspect of strategic bankroll management for variance options. Which variance type offers the largest potential single-session wins? High variance, due to its rare but massive payout spikes, typically provides the greatest jackpot potential per spin.

HTML5 Technology Across Devices

HTML5 technology ensures online slots operate seamlessly across devices by eliminating reliance on third-party plugins like Flash. Its inherent cross-platform compatibility allows games to render consistently on desktops, tablets, and smartphones through a single codebase. Responsive game interfaces automatically adjust layout and touch inputs, preserving spin mechanics and reel animations regardless of screen size. The sequential rendering process begins with a server call delivering HTML5 assets, then client-side cascading style sheets (CSS) adapt grid dimensions, followed by JavaScript event handlers mapping tap gestures for mobile interaction.

  1. Server delivers elements and sprite sheets to the browser.
  2. CSS media queries scale the slot matrix and button positions to viewport width.
  3. JavaScript touch listeners override mouse events for smooth drag-to-spin responses.
  4. Hardware-accelerated WebGL or CSS3 transforms handle 3D reel rotations without lag.

Third-Party Audits and Data Security

Third-party audits verify that online slot outcomes are not manipulated. Independent firms,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s, test random number generators (RNGs) to ensure each spin’s result is unpredictable and statistically fair. This process checks for hidden code that could skew payout percentages. Data security in this context means the audit also reviews how the casino protects your personal and financial information during transactions. Encryption protocols, like TLS, are examined to confirm transmitted data remains unreadable to attackers. Independent RNG certification directly links audit integrity to your protection against fraud.

Q: Do audits also check if my slot login details are stored safely? Yes. Auditors assess encryption practices for stored account credentials and financial data, ensuring they are not accessible to unauthorized parties, which prevents identity theft or fund loss.

Influence of Bet Size on Win Probability

A common myth is that betting more increases your odds of winning. In reality, online slots use a Random Number Generator (RNG), meaning bet size has no impact on win probability. Each spin is an independent event, so a max bet does not unlock better chances. While larger bets may trigger higher-value jackpots on certain progressive games, the base probability of a win or loss remains identical regardless of wager. To debunk this clearly:

  1. RNG determines outcomes per spin, unlinked to your stake.
  2. Return-to-Player (RTP) percentages apply equally to all bets.
  3. Only payout amounts scale with bet size, not the chance of hitting a win.

RTP, Hit Frequency, and Variance

RTP (Return to Player) represents the theoretical percentage of total stakes a slot returns over extended play, such as 96%. Hit Frequency indicates how often a spin produces any win, often a lower percentage like 20-30%, meaning frequent small payouts. Variance, or volatility, measures risk level: low variance slots deliver consistent small wins with stable RTP, while high variance slots offer larger but rarer payouts, potentially swinging outcomes far from the expected RTP. Players choose based on preference for steady play versus high-risk jackpots.

online slots

Term What It Tells You Example Value
RTP Long-term return percentage 96%
Hit Frequency Chance of a win per spin 25%
Variance Win size consistency vs. risk Low / Medium / High

Auto-Play, Turbo Mode, and Quickspin

Auto-Play, Turbo Mode, and Quickspin are speed-enhancing features in online slots. Auto-Play lets you set a predetermined number of automatic spins, often with loss or win limits. Turbo Mode dramatically accelerates the spinning animation, reducing screen time between spins for faster results. Quickspin, frequently synonymous with Turbo, speeds up individual reel animations without skipping the spin sequence. These tools allow players to increase session throughput but do not alter the underlying Return to Player (RTP) or game volatility. They are purely quality-of-life settings for expedited gameplay.

Auto-Play automates spin sequences, Turbo Mode cuts animation delays, and Quickspin accelerates reel reaction times—all for faster, uninterrupted slot sessions.
